The Setting and Location

The escape room is located just above the Continent supermarket in Aveiro. The entrance is a narrow, rocky lane, making it easy to miss if you’re not paying attention. Parking is available at the end of this lane—convenient for visitors arriving by car. The meeting point is straightforward, with clear directions, ensuring you won’t spend time wandering around trying to find it.

The Storyline and Theme

This escape room isn’t your typical puzzle game. You’re stepping into the shoes of detectives trying to prevent two ghostly entities from reincarnating in children. These entities are linked to traumatized souls of people who suffered abuse and mental health issues—passing through psychiatric hospitals without improvement. When they died, they sought a second chance at life, but their unresolved secrets make them dangerous.

The narrative is dark and morbid, with some shocking revelations about the past of these entities. The story has real emotional weight, making solving puzzles feel more urgent and personal. According to reviews, “the story is compelling and keeps you engaged”, with some players noting the experience feels like a mini horror story with supernatural overtones.

The Puzzle Elements

The puzzles are closely tied to the story, meaning you’ll need to interpret clues that reveal the secrets of these two people’s troubled pasts. Expect a mix of riddles, codes, and hidden clues—nothing overly complex but requiring attention to detail and teamwork. Some reviewers mention that “the puzzles are well-integrated into the storyline”, which makes the experience feel cohesive rather than just a collection of random tasks.

One aspect that guests appreciate is the use of ghost manifestations as an interactive element—sometimes appearing unexpectedly to increase the suspense. This adds a layer of tension but should be noted for those sensitive to sudden surprises or with claustrophobia.

Duration and Group Size

The activity lasts around one hour, making it an ideal short escape from sightseeing. It’s designed for private groups, which means you’ll be playing with just your friends or family—no strangers sharing the experience. This setup fosters better teamwork and makes the narrative more personal.

Accessibility and Practical Tips

It’s recommended to wear comfortable shoes and bring water, as you’ll be moving around in a confined space for the duration. The activity is not suitable for children under 12, or anyone uncomfortable with dark, supernatural themes, tight spaces, or sudden manifestations.

Guests suggest arriving 10-15 minutes early to settle in and get briefed. The support staff is multilingual, speaking English, Portuguese, and Spanish, which makes communication easier for international visitors.
